Find LCM of 848,240,334,424 with Prime Factorization
2 | 848, 240, 334, 424 |
2 | 424, 120, 167, 212 |
2 | 106, 60, 167, 212 |
2 | 53, 30, 167, 106 |
53 | 53, 15, 167, 53 |
1, 15, 167, 1 |
Multiply the prime numbers at the bottom and the left side.
2 x 2 x 2 x 2 x 53 x 1 x 15 x 167 x 1 = 2124240
Therefore, the lowest common multiple of 848,240,334,424 is 2124240.
